Design Features for Professional Use

The design of the AT2035 emphasizes versatility and user convenience. Its large-diaphragm condenser capsule delivers a wide frequency response, capturing detailed sound with precision. The microphone includes multiple features tailored for professional studios, such as a switchable high-pass filter and 10 dB pad, allowing users to adapt to various recording scenarios.
